Does anyone remember an MIT Media Lab(?) project called Immersion(?), which let you input your email account and showed you your network of contacts via the to/from metadata? It's gone--but does something like it still exist?

@inquiline the Center for Collective Learning open sourced the Immersion project, which appears to have been written in Java and Python.

Much would depend on whether the gmail client code still works.

thanks!! this post might be useful in future semesters. in the past i recalled doing the tool myself and showing my results in class, and stressing to the students that there was no one else on earth connected to both my mom and my department chair, e.g. (the point of the lesson was ofc that even if message contents can't be intercepted without court orders, the NSA knows who i am and a lot about me just with the metadata, which it illustrated very well)
